What is included

/01

Audit of the current site

We review analytics, user behaviour, speed and rankings. A redesign starts by understanding what is actually broken.

/02

New structure

Navigation rebuilt around what visitors are really trying to do. This, more often than the visuals, is what lifts enquiries.

/03

Design in Figma

Mockups before development. We agree the direction first, details second — that keeps revisions down.

/04

SEO preserved

We map old URLs to new, add 301 redirects and carry over meta tags, so rankings hold.

/05

Content migration

Copy, images and case studies moved over, with anything outdated or duplicated cleaned out along the way.

/06

Post-launch monitoring

Two weeks watching Search Console and analytics: crawl errors, ranking shifts, user behaviour.

FAQ

Will I lose my search rankings?

That is the main risk of any redesign, and a redirect map closes it: every old URL points to its new equivalent. We monitor Search Console for two weeks after launch.

Can we refresh the design without rebuilding everything?

Yes, if the technical foundation is sound. Sometimes rebuilding a few key pages is all it takes — faster and cheaper.

Will the site stay up during the work?

Yes. Development happens on a private copy and the switchover takes minutes, outside business hours.

What if our site is on a website builder?

We migrate to WordPress preserving URLs and adding redirects. In return you get control of the code and no platform subscription.

How long does a redesign take?

Usually 3–5 weeks. Most of that is design sign-off and content migration rather than development itself.

Can we keep our logo and brand colours?

Of course. A website redesign does not have to mean a rebrand — if your identity works, we work within it.
